Boeing Commercial Airplanes is hiring a Composites Manufacturing Planner located in Everett Washington. This individual will serve as a contributor to help support Test and Emergent Capability and Capacity requests for composite components and develop work instructions to build those products. Implementation and sustainment of new and existing build plans that manufacture and repair Test and Emergent parts that significantly impact the quality and cost performance of the program. This role will require individuals that are capable of adapting to a dynamic team with critical deliverables and urgent factory support. They will need to have the ability to collaborate with others while keeping an open mindset while adapting to various statements of work.
Our team is currently hiring for a broad range of experience levels including Associate and Mid-Level Manufacturing Planners.

Pay and Benefits:
At Boeing we strive to deliver a Total Rewards package that will attract engage and retain the top talent. Elements of the Total Rewards package include competitive base pay and variable compensation opportunities.
The Boeing Company also provides eligible employees with an opportunity to enroll in a variety of benefit programs generally including health insurance flexible spending accounts health savings accounts retirement savings plans life and disability insurance programs and a number of programs that provide for both paid and unpaid time away from work.
The specific programs and options available to any given employee may vary depending on eligibility factors such as geographic location date of hire and the applicability of collective bargaining agreements.
Pay is based upon candidate experience and qualifications as well as market and business considerations.
Summary pay range for Associate (Level 2): $60350 - $81650
Summary pay range for Mid-level (Level 3): $69700 - $94300
